Broadway Financial Corporation (BYFC)
NASDAQ: BYFC · IEX Real-Time Price · USD
5.34
-0.13 (-2.38%)
Jul 2, 2024, 4:00 PM EDT - Market closed

Broadway Financial Ratios and Metrics

Millions USD. Fiscal year is Jan - Dec.
Year
Current20232022202120202019 2018 - 1996
Market Capitalization
4963771665243
Upgrade
Market Cap Growth
-36.17%-18.27%-53.53%219.61%20.86%49.07%
Upgrade
Enterprise Value
3633552678670117
Upgrade
PE Ratio
18.4113.9513.67-40.93-80.79-208.33
Upgrade
PS Ratio
1.481.862.336.903.943.73
Upgrade
PB Ratio
0.170.220.281.181.060.88
Upgrade
P/FCF Ratio
-6.298.5312.84-322.54-3.715.05
Upgrade
P/OCF Ratio
-6.508.2912.18265.68-3.835.03
Upgrade
EV/Sales Ratio
11.0110.468.073.585.2810.13
Upgrade
EV/EBITDA Ratio
75.7948.7430.11-20.01-74.97-360.24
Upgrade
EV/EBIT Ratio
89.9554.5633.14-17.28-66.33-211.83
Upgrade
EV/FCF Ratio
-44.8948.0144.45-167.66-4.9813.74
Upgrade
Debt / Equity Ratio
1.351.410.741.082.331.83
Upgrade
Debt / EBITDA Ratio
79.6354.5523.23-35.27-122.65-275.83
Upgrade
Debt / FCF Ratio
-46.8553.7234.30-295.55-8.1510.52
Upgrade
Asset Turnover
0.030.030.030.030.030.03
Upgrade
Return on Equity (ROE)
1.00%1.60%2.30%-3.40%-1.30%-0.40%
Upgrade
Return on Assets (ROA)
0.20%0.40%0.50%-0.40%-0.10%0.00%
Upgrade
Return on Capital (ROIC)
0.42%0.67%1.17%-1.67%-0.64%-0.27%
Upgrade
Earnings Yield
5.70%7.17%7.32%-2.44%-1.24%-0.48%
Upgrade
FCF Yield
-16.68%11.73%7.79%-0.31%-26.93%19.79%
Upgrade
Buyback Yield / Dilution
2.69%2.69%-6.29%-155.97%-0.61%-1.64%
Upgrade
Total Shareholder Return
2.69%2.69%-6.29%-155.97%-0.61%-1.64%
Upgrade
Source: Financials are provided by Nasdaq Data Link and sourced from the audited annual (10-K) and quarterly (10-Q) reports submitted to the Securities and Exchange Commission (SEC).